India, Australia forge defence ties to check China’s Indo‑Pacific ambitions

India and Australia are forging a robust defence partnership to counter China’s Indo-Pacific assertiveness. Focusing on practical cooperation, they’ve inked a logistics agreement for reciprocal base access and expanded joint military exercises. Enhanced maritime domain awareness and defence technology collaboration are key, alongside army-to-army engagements. This deepening alliance aims to ensure a multipolar and stable region.
